小编Ank*_*ain的帖子

如何在awt中关闭窗口?

我在awt中创建了一个小的应用程序,当我关闭窗口时,关闭按钮不起作用,但是我已经添加了关闭按钮的功能,之后关闭按钮不起作用...

import java.awt.*;
import java.applet.*;
import java.awt.event.*;
import javax.swing.*;

class ButtonDemo1 implements ActionListener {
    Button b1;
    TextField tf;
    Frame f;

    ButtonDemo1(String s) {
        f = new Frame(s);
        b1 = new Button("OK");

        tf = new TextField(10);
        f.setSize(200, 250);
        f.setVisible(true);
        b1.addActionListener(this);

        f.add(tf);
        f.add(b1);

        f.addWindowListener(new WindowAdapter() {
            public void windowClosing(WindowEvent we) {
                System.exit(0);
            }
        });

        f.setLayout(new FlowLayout());
    }

    public void actionPerformed(ActionEvent e) {
        if (e.getSource() == b1) {
            tf.setText("Press Ok");
        }

    }

    public static void main(String args[]) {
        new ButtonDemo1("First");
    }
}
Run Code Online (Sandbox Code Playgroud)

为什么关闭按钮不起作用?

java awt

9
推荐指数
2
解决办法
5万
查看次数

窗口大小改变时在WPF中调用的方法?

我正在使用WPF创建一个应用程序.我想计算画布可见区域的坐标.

当我调整窗口大小时将调用哪个方法,以便我可以在调整窗口大小时计算坐标?

wpf

4
推荐指数
1
解决办法
7137
查看次数

最后一次成功从服务器接收到的数据包是在 43417 秒前

我们使用 Spring 4.2.5、Hibernate 4.1.4、MYSql 来构建 REST 服务。我们面临着非常奇怪的问题,无法理解到底发生了什么并出现以下错误:

\n\n

最后一次从服务器成功接收的数据包是在 43417 秒前。最后一次成功发送到服务器的数据包是在 43417 秒前,这比服务器配置的“wait_timeout”值要长。您应该考虑在应用程序中使用之前使连接过期和/或测试连接有效性,增加客户端超时的服务器配置值,或使用 Connector/J 连接属性“autoReconnect=true”来避免此问题。

\n\n

为了获得数据库连接,我们使用基于 java 的配置,如下所示:

\n\n
    @Configuration\n    @EnableTransactionManagement\n    @ComponentScan({ "api.configuration" })\n\npublic class HibernateConfiguration {\n    @Autowired\n    private Environment environment;\n\n    private static final Logger logger = LoggerFactory.getLogger(HibernateConfiguration.class);\n    @Bean\n    public LocalSessionFactoryBean sessionFactory() throws PropertyVetoException {\n        LocalSessionFactoryBean sessionFactory = new LocalSessionFactoryBean();\n        sessionFactory.setDataSource(dataSource());\n        sessionFactory.setPackagesToScan(new String[] { "api.domain" });\n        sessionFactory.setHibernateProperties(hibernateProperties());\n        return sessionFactory;\n     }\n\n    @Bean\n    public DataSource dataSource() {\n        DriverManagerDataSource dataSource = new DriverManagerDataSource();\n        dataSource.setDriverClassName("com.mysql.jdbc.Driver");\n        dataSource.setUrl("jdbc:mysql://localhost:3306/test?autoReconnect=true");\n        dataSource.setUsername("test"); \n        dataSource.setPassword("test");\n        return dataSource;\n    }\n\n\n    private …
Run Code Online (Sandbox Code Playgroud)

mysql spring hibernate

3
推荐指数
1
解决办法
2万
查看次数

如何一次又一次地停止页面加载?

我在asp.net中创建在线应用程序,页面上有一些下拉列表,当我从下拉列表页面中选择一些项目时再次调用load,我该如何阻止这个?

asp.net

0
推荐指数
1
解决办法
1475
查看次数

标签 统计

asp.net ×1

awt ×1

hibernate ×1

java ×1

mysql ×1

spring ×1

wpf ×1